导航:首页 > 源码编译 > vc编译自动改编码

vc编译自动改编码

发布时间:2023-08-23 02:33:10

A. VC++ 怎么改变文件的编码为 UTF-8

这个暂时没有一步实现的方法,首先你要先理解原理 WINDOWS内部是使用宽字节的,用的是unicode 所以你首先要把 ANSI=>Unicode,用函数MultiByteToWideChar实现 然后再把Unicode=>UTF8,用函数WideCharToMultiByte实现 原理就这样,至于具体怎么用

B. VC++中如何改变文件编码方式

据我所知,VC里对于文件不管什么编码的,对于VC来说它只认识二进制数据。比较接近物理底层,呵呵,我刚从VC转向.net的时候也对.net的编码郁闷了一段时间。

你可以使用_T("")宏把字符串转成UNICODE编码,不如_T("Hello World!"),不过可不能再保存到char数组里了,微软给我们准备了一个TCHAR,其实就是一个 short int型数组,UNICODE 需要2个字节来表示一个数组,现在只要把TCHAR内存块写进文件就OK了,对C++来说它还是一串二进制数据。

另外,微软极力建议使用_T("")宏,所以请不要嫌麻烦,养成好的习惯是非常重要的!

C. VC 中如何改变文件编码方式

在菜单: file/advanced save options/unicode utf8这里设置;
带签名指文件头包含编码信息。
EF BB BF,这三个字节代码这个文件时UTF8编码。
FF FE:代表这是 UTF16 LE(小字节序)编码 。
FE FF : 代表是 UTF16 BE(大字节序)。
详细的资料可以去查询UNICODE编码规范。

阅读全文

与vc编译自动改编码相关的资料

热点内容
哪些人需要阅读源码 浏览:622
程序员汉中 浏览:334
电脑桌面文件加密了忘记密码了 浏览:388
安卓手机怎么下载lark 浏览:935
单片机课程设计密码锁 浏览:474
云帮手管理几个服务器 浏览:612
安卓系统如何给软件添加密码 浏览:598
上海普陀哪里有ug编程培训学校 浏览:115
multikey写入加密狗 浏览:403
网上银行服务器反馈地址 浏览:481
酷狗音乐存放音乐的文件夹 浏览:600
文件夹支架图片 浏览:901
毛笔app哪个好 浏览:467
程序员在厂里打工怎么样 浏览:807
泰安联想加密u盘哪里买 浏览:617
有什么单机听音乐的app 浏览:580
oppor11服务器地址 浏览:190
传统版布林线源码 浏览:748
app黑色是什么原因 浏览:621
王者荣耀如何说自己是程序员 浏览:734